Access one of your courses by clicking on the title in the Course Lists channel 2. Click on Syllabus from the Course Tools list 3. You have now accessed the Syllabus</p><p>Post a Message to a discussion Board 1. Access one of your courses by clicking on the title in the Course Lists channel 2. Click on Discussions from the Course Tools list 3. Click on Default Topic 4. Click on Create Message 5. You can now enter a subject and a message 6. Click Post 7. Your message is added to the discussion topic</p><p>Send an email 1. Access one of your courses by clicking on the title in the Course Lists channel 2. Click on Mail from the Course Tools list 3. Click on Create Message 4. Click on Browse for recipients 5. Click in the checkbox that corresponds to “To All Section Instructors”</p><p>6. Access one of your courses by clicking on the title in the Course Lists channel 2. Click on Assessments from the Course Tools list 3. Any assessments currently available will be listed on the right hand side 4. Click on the title of the assessment </p><p>5. Read through the detail about the assessment e.g. Dates available, assessment duration, number of attempts allowed etc 6. Click on Begin Assessment 7. Work through the questions in turn 8. Click Save Answer when you are happy with an answer to a question</p><p>9.
